Abstract

Systems and methods for extracting behavioral code from a software code file are disclosed. A behavioral code extractor logic accesses an existing software code file that comprises structural code and behavioral code. The behavioral code extractor logic extracts, from the software code file, at least a portion of the behavioral code into a separate file. And, the behavioral code extractor logic generates binding code for referencing the extracted behavioral code to maintain run-time behavior of the software code file consistent with its run-time behavior before the extracting. In certain embodiments, the software code file is a source file for a web page, and the structural code comprises markup language code. The behavioral code may comprise scripting language code and/or event attributes code defined by markup language.

Claims (58)

1. A computer-implemented method comprising:

accessing a software code file that comprises structural code and behavioral code;

extracting from the software code file, at least a portion of the behavioral code into a separate file;

generating binding code for referencing the extracted behavioral code to maintain run-time behavior of the software code file consistent with its run-time behavior before said extracting, wherein behavioral code extractor logic inserts into the software code file said binding code for referencing the extracted behavioral code; and

wherein said extracting comprises enabling, by a user interface, selection of one or more of identified behavioral code that is to be extracted from the software code file into the separate file; and

extracting the selected one or more of the identified behavioral code from the software code file into the separate file.

2. The method of claim 1 wherein said accessing, extracting, and generating are performed by behavioral code extractor logic.

3. The method of claim 2 wherein said behavioral code extracting logic is part of a software code authoring tool in which said software code file is being authored.

4. The method of claim 1 wherein said structural code comprises markup language code.

5. The method of claim 4 wherein said behavioral code comprises scripting language code.

6. The method of claim 5 wherein said scripting language code comprises JavaScript code.

7. The method of claim 4 wherein said behavioral code comprises event attributes defined by markup language code.

8. The method of claim 1 wherein said software code file comprises a source file for a web page.

9. The method of claim 1 wherein said extracting is responsive to a user request input to a software code authoring tool.

10. The method of claim 1 wherein said extracting comprises:

identifying the behavioral code contained in the software code file; and

presenting the user interface that includes a list of the identified behavioral code contained in the software code file.
